USF Launches Telecom Services Project for Balochistan | InfoZonePK

Universal Service Fund has given away one of the largest Projects related to Rural Telecom Services for Mastung Lot (Balochistan) that are going to value as high as PKR 3.15 Billion.

A statement issued by Federal Minister-IT, Raja Pervan Ashraf witnessed the signing ceremony the project.

Mr. Ashraf was quoted as saying that through the Rural Telecom Project in Mastung, basic telephony and data services will be provided to a population of 74,831 people which resides in 102 un-served mauzas of Balochihtan.

He said this Lot consists of Mastung, Nushki and Ziarat Districts. He praised the USF team for following Public Procurement Regulatory Authority (PPRA) rules throughout the bidding process.

During chairing the 28th USF Board Meeting, Minister IT also approved launch of 5 new projects of rural rtelecom for next fiscal year 2012-13, namely Kech, Kalat, Panjgoor, Sibi and Zhob lots in Balochistan province. He also approved launch of three new projects f Broadband programme for Western Telecom Region (Balochistan), Northern Telecom Region I and II (KPK), and lastly he also approved the launch of optical fiber cable project for KPK Province.
